Ankita Sengupta is a journalist for moneycontrol.com, focusing on national news in India. She covers a wide range of topics including human interest stories, social issues, entertainment, and scams. With a knack for finding unique stories that resonate with readers, Ankita brings a fresh perspective to her reporting.

Ankita's coverage mainly focuses on personal finance and entertainment news, particularly in the context of India. She often includes expert commentary and announcements in her articles.

To effectively reach out to Ankita, consider providing insights or analysis related to personal finance matters within the Indian context. Additionally, if you have expertise in entertainment news with relevance to India, such as celebrity interviews or industry trends, it would likely align well with her coverage.

Given Ankita's national geographic focus on India, ensure that any pitches are relevant and tailored specifically to this region.
